          RIP. He grew up in Port Dalhousie on Lake Ontario which is pretty scenic w lots of restaurants and bars, 14 miles away from where I grew up actually. I knew his high school from sports (he had graduated years earlier though) . We were listening to 2112 and Fly by Night in high school a lot. They wrote a song called 'Lakeside Park' about a popular park in the area I know well and many people visit in the summers.

          They were hugely popular in the area and were the fav band of many and he will be missed.
